Analisando propostas

Criação de um conjunto de páginas ou módulos para gestão de cálculos de cardápio em Php + Mysql.

Publicado em 20 de Outubro de 2022 dias na TI e Programação

Sobre este projeto

Aberto

O sistema será baseado nas seguintes premissas...

O cliente comtratará o acesso ao cálculo dos cardápios através da eduzz que gerará uma chamada de webhook.
Cada cliente poderá ter mais de um cardápio diferente, cada um com seu login e senha que poderão ser alterados pelo usuário.
O contrato de acesso a cada cardápio terá duração de 1 ano.
Após este prazo o acesso será desativado, ou em caso de chargeback (manualmente).
O cliente terá acesso a uma página de gestãos, para configurar seus cardápios.
O cliente terá acesso a uma página de produção, onde os cáculos serão executados.
O gestor do sistema terá acesso a uma página de Administração do Sistema.

Na página de gestão, o cliente poderá:
- Configurar login e senha de acesso a tela de gestão; (o primeiro será gerado pelo sistema)
- Visualizar os cardápios contratados;
- Visualizar a quantidades de acessos as páginas de produção de cada cardápio por um período configurável (calendário para definir o período)
- Alterar seus dados pessoais que aparecerão nas páginas de produção (nome, e-mail, whatsapp e foto)
- Alterar os dados de acesso de cada cardápio contratado (login, senha, Título e texto a ser exibido)

Na página de produção de cada cardápio ( a página é sempre a mesma, muda apenas o nome do cardápio):
- O acesso será liberado mediante login e senha cadastrado pelo cliente.
- Aparecerão os dados do cliente (nome, e-mail, whatsapp e foto), se configurados na tela de gestão.
- Aparecerão campos para coleta de dados para cálculo do cardápio (altura, peso, idade e sexo).
- Será executado um cálculo para consumo de água (0,30 x o número de Kg do peso).
- Será executado um cálculo de necessidade calórica
    Conforme a combinação de altura, sexo, peso e idade direciona para uma de 4 opções.

    Formula usada:

    Para os homens:  TMB = 66 + (13,8 x peso em kg.) + (5 x altura em cm) - (6,8 x idade em anos).
    Para as mulheres: TMB = 655 + (9,6 x peso em kg.) + (1,8 x altura em cm) - (4,7 x idade em anos)

    Se o resultado for:

    800 < Resultado < 1300  --> Chama página 1 (cada tipo de cardápio terá seus links específicos)
    1301 < Resultado < 1600 --> Chama página 2
    1601 < Resultado < 1900 --> Chama página 3
    1901 < Resultado < 5000 --> Chama página 4

- Espaço para mostrar uma imagem de propaganda com link externo.


Na página de Administração do Sistema, o gestor poderá:
- Consultar a quantidade de cardápios ativos e inativos
- Tirar relatórios por período configurável:
    - Cardápios contratados
    - Cardápios inativos
    - Acessso por tipo de cardápio
    - Acesso por cliente
    - Para um cliente específico mostra os cardápios contratados e respectivos acessos.
    - Contratos que vão vencer no período especificado.
    - Tentativas de login para cada contrato vencido.
- Cadastrar e alterar dados dos cardápios (Nome, descrição, link páginas 1, 2, 3 e 4)
- Cadastrar e alterar dados do cliente (login, senha, email, foto e textos)
- Alterar dados dos cardápios do cliente (exibe propaganda s/n, imagem propaganda e link propaganda).

Contexto Geral do Projeto

Modelo de versão beta da página de produção: https://semanaemagrecedora.com.br/imb-ddx/ Esta página será disponibilizada aos pacientes do cliente para que eles descubram sua necessiade de cálculo de cardápio. Quero publicar este sistema em um servidor wordpress que já tem outras páginas. As páginas podem ser php, wordpress, elementor ou optimizepress.

Categoria TI e Programação
Subcategoria Wordpress
Qual é o alcance do projeto? Desenvolvimento personalizado
Isso é um projeto ou uma posição de trabalho? Um projeto
Tenho, atualmente Eu tenho especificações
Disponibilidade requerida Conforme necessário
Integrações de API Payment Processor (Paypal, Stripe, etc)

Prazo de Entrega: 27 de Agosto de 2022

Habilidades necessárias

Outro projetos publicados por R. S. I.